Perched above the landscape, not on top of it 🌿
Our Kelmscott project came to us as a two-storey design from another practice — beautiful on paper, but the site had other plans. After digging into the earthworks, retaining and structural implications, we redesigned the home as a single level, elevated on posts to work with the natural fall of the land instead of cutting into it.
The result? The same brief, the same lifestyle the clients wanted — for roughly $500K less.
Site works are one of the most overlooked parts of the design process, and one of the biggest drivers of budget blowouts. The land always has the final say, and the earlier you bring the right consultants to the table, the more room you have to design smart instead of paying to fix problems later.
This is why we push for early engagement on every project — a good design team isn’t just drawing pretty elevations, it’s protecting your budget from decisions made before the ground’s even been tested.
